The Technology Behind Quick Transaction Processing


Modern financial technology has enabled casino operators to process withdrawals within seconds not hours. This speed increase stems from multiple tech advances operating together. Transaction handlers now leverage API-driven systems that connect straight to bank systems, eliminating numerous middleman processes that previously caused delays.

The foundation supporting real-time cash-outs relies on pre-verified player accounts. Sophisticated KYC (User Authentication) verification occurs during registration rather than at fund access, homepage bypassing the traditional bottleneck. Protection Systems in Quick Transfers


Quick handling preserves security in well-designed frameworks. Advanced platforms employ stacked protection protocols that work instantly. Biometric verification, device recognition, and activity pattern systems work concurrently to validate genuine withdrawals while detecting suspicious activity.

Real-time fraud detection systems analyze multiple indicators per withdrawal. Automated intelligence systems educated by extensive data sets recognize irregularities that could suggest illegal actions. This computerized oversight actually provides superior security compared to manual review processes that characterized old-style operations.

Technical Requirements for Integration


Establishing rapid payout systems requires considerable system expenditure. Platforms must link to payment processors providing immediate processing functions. Core platforms require enhancement to process the expanded processing load without constraints.

Database architecture must support rapid query execution and alteration tasks. Traffic distribution becomes essential as transaction submissions don't wait in collective completion. System redundancy maintains uninterrupted service even during high-volume times.
